The Network for Social Change
is a new program of the Forest Foundation designed to provide seed money
to young social entrepreneurs between ages 18 to 25 passionately committed
to implanting projects of social change. The Network is a devoted community
of social change activists armed with a passion for great ideas that
benefit local, national, and international communities. Directors within
the Network are like-minded leaders seeking to better themselves and
the community through mentors, personal growth, and each other. The Network generally, but

The Network for Social Change
prefers sustainable, endurable projects that produce marked and measured
change for specific groups and sectors in society. The Network
does not sponsor pending projects, but those that are “ready to go,”
and have proven to be prepared for financial assistance. Local,
uncomplicated projects are highly encouraged; the Network is not
in quest of miracle projects but tangible, socially conscious programs
that visibly benefit a specific community. There are 4 deadlines to apply
to the Network: October 15th, January 15th, April
15th, and July 15th. Up to Four Directors may
be hired in each “round.” Applicants who are unable to apply
or are not accepted are free to apply again. The Network for Social Change
provides each project with maximum of $10,000 in grant money, which
is typically awarded in 4 installments paid to organizations over the
course of 12 months. Grants are not awarded to individuals. Directors
are to form ties and create projects associated with pre-existing organizations.
Directors have the option of devoting a portion of the grant as a personal
stipend and must indicate specific amounts in proposed budgets. Directors may
seek additional sources of funding for their project. However, Directorship
in the Network obligates participation in retreats, communicating with
the team, and logo display in all materials associated with their project. Since the Network
